Hasani
Hasani Pronunciation
Hasani is pronounced hah-SAH-nee /hɑˈsɑ.ni/Medium
Meaning: From Swahili Hasani (via Arabic hasan), 'handsome, good, beautiful'Medium

History & Origin
Hasani comes from Swahili Hasani — via Arabic hasan, 'handsome, good, beautiful'. A warm, soft, popular name across East Africa (and African American families).
In the U.S. it appears across communities. Rare, handsome-and-good at the root, and warm.
